Exploring Ruinart Champagne Pricing
Delve into the captivating world of Ruinart Champagne, renowned for its exceptional excellence. The value of Ruinart Champagne can differ considerably based on a multitude of elements, including the vintage, size, and limited availability. For discerning enthusiasts, Ruinart offers a selection of prestige cuvées that command significant costs.
- The House of Ruinart has been creating Champagne for over three centuries.
- From the iconic Blanc de Blancs to the bold Brut, Ruinart's portfolio offers a variety of styles
- Collectors eagerly seek out rare and coveted Ruinart vintages.

Bollinger Champagne: A Legacy of Excellence
Bollinger Champagne stands as a testament to the mastery of champagne creation. Each bottle is a symbol of impeccable quality, crafted from finest grapes grown in the esteemed vineyards of Champagne, France. The house style of Bollinger is characterized by its complex flavor profile, with notes of brioche and a long-lasting finish. It's this classic appeal that has made Bollinger a favorite among connoisseurs and celebrators alike.
Bollinger's commitment to excellence extends beyond the vineyard, with a meticulous production process that guarantees the highest standards. From harvesting to fermentation and aging, every step is meticulously controlled to preserve the integrity and complexity of the grapes. The result is a champagne that surpasses expectations, offering a truly unforgettable drinking experience.
